About the Role

Culmen International is hiring a Senior Director, MOSAICS to open and scale a new Commercial / Fortune 500 revenue stream for the MOSAICS platform - Culmen's enterprise-grade SaaS for situational awareness, critical event management, and decision intelligence.

This is a senior individual contributor role. You will own a personal quota and run the full sales cycle into F500 corporate security, global security operations centers (GSOCs), supply-chain risk, business continuity, and enterprise risk leaders. There is no team underneath you at hire; for the right operator with proven leadership, this role has a clear path to Head of MOSAICS Commercial Sales as the commercial book scales.

You will displace and out-position incumbents including Everbridge, Crisis24, Dataminr, and AlertMedia, leveraging MOSAICS' differentiated AI fusion, modular packaging, and Premise ground-truth data integration.
